Crossfire 1.5.0 server

Crossfire 1.5 now uses a huge world map, and a proper weather system.

The first image is generated from the world maps themselves, so you should be able to see some detail. The grid lines represent map boundaries, but since map tiling is in use, you won't see them in the game. This image does not include weather effects. Click on the small image below to see it.

The second image is a snapshot of the weather conditions taken about every two minutes which is how often the weather gets recalculated. This represents one hour of gametime. Reload this page every now and then to watch the changing weather conditions. Note the gulf stream and equator, which is diagonal! Unless otherwise stated, a darker colour represents a lower number. For the rainfall and windspeed maps, red represents higher than average rainfall or windspeed.
